Re: Retirement of the Stonebriar product line

Stonebriar sales have declined for five consecutive quarters and support costs now exceed contribution margin. The retirement plan is staged: new orders close end of Q2, existing contracts honoured through their terms, and spares stocked for twenty-four months. Sales leads should steer prospects toward the Ashgrove range; migration incentives are already approved. Customer comms are drafted and awaiting legal sign-off. The forward strategy behind this decision is set out in the note below.

confidential, yafog-hagug: Gross margin on Druix came in at 10 percent against a plan of 15 percent. Only 5 of the 80 pilot accounts renewed Druix, so a churn review is set for October 1.

Ticket: SCRUB-412 — Connection failures in EXIF scrub worker

The Ochre Pipeline EXIF scrubber intermittently fails to connect after pool exhaustion during bulk uploads. Symptoms: timeouts in the strip stage, then a backlog of unprocessed images. Workaround for now is raising the pool ceiling and restarting the worker. Future maintainers should check pool metrics before assuming network issues. The worker connects to the metadata store with the connection string below.

primary connection of tajeg-tajop = postgresql://julax_svc:DI@db-e7f3.kelvidyn.corp:5432/rusdor

## Environment Variables

The Sentrybird watchdog monitors kiosk units running the Glimmerbox app and reboots any kiosk that stops heartbeating. All configuration lives in /opt/sentrybird/.env on each unit. Most variables control polling intervals and retry limits and can stay at their defaults. The watchdog cannot report status to the fleet dashboard without its reporting credential, so ensure the file contains this line:

env line for fafof-fahag: LEDGER_TOKEN5=f8790